What is Affiliate Marketing?
Affiliate marketing describes a method which a firm could make even more sales by making use of associates. Affiliates are individuals that advertise another firm's items. The associate makes a commission on every sale that she or he created. It's comparable to exactly what used to exist prior to the Internet, where sales agents would obtain clients and after that be paid a compensation for each sale made. The Mechanics of Affiliate Marketing
This marketing program generates leads and sales when the affiliate uses an affiliate link anytime that they mention the merchant on their website or social media page. When a potential customer visits the affiliate's website and clicks on the link, he or she is taken to the merchant's website. At the same time, a cookie gets recorded on the customer's computer. The customer then makes a purchase from the merchant's website. As he logs out, the merchant sees a cookie that belongs to a specific affiliate and thereafter makes a credit for the sale to the affiliate. The commission payments are usually made after certain time periods, such as on a monthly basis.
Where to Find Affiliate Programs
I think one of the most common questions that most people interested in becoming affiliates ask is about where to find the best products to promote. There are several affiliate programs available but it's always advisable to choose a reputable one. Joining a well establilshed affiliate network is a great idea. This would be the most ideal place to start because such networks are usually well organized and trusted. Well established networks are typically large and have existing relationships with some of the biggest brands. Chances are that if you are searching for an affiliate program to drive the sales of a common brand, you'll most likely find it being run through established affiliate networks. Promoting Familiar Products and Services
You can always start by promoting a brand that you use yourself or are well aware of. It's always easy to sell what you already believe in as opposed to just trying to convince customers to buy a product that you've never even used before. You can check the sites of your favorite brands and see if they have affiliate programs. It's a safe bet and somehow a familiar ground even for beginners.
In this model you can write reviews or record yourself reviewing an item for YouTube. This is how you promote a product with a lot of authority because you've used it and have enjoyed its benefits. When you post content on your blog, you speak to visitors on the account of personal experience. This type of affiliate marketing is very effective because most of the time, consumers find it more convincing. People will be willing to try out something just because you, as an influencer, have used it and found it to be good. It is even more effective when your blog or social media site has many followers.

Promoting Niche Products and Services
These products will be related to the niche that your site focuses on. Visitors may come to your site because of the products that you are promoting but they can also find additional products through these links. You don't have to have used the product in order to provide a link for it. These programs can be run by the merchants themselves using affiliate software to take care of the technical aspects of the system. The advantage of independent affiliate networks rather than huge affiliate networks is that the pay is much better since they don't use middle men. However, you can also find great related products on an affiliate network. You can get links and promote them on your blog, social media sites, videos or podcasts.
